It is likewise crucial to understand the Mental Health Parity and Addiction Equity Act of 2008, which is a federal law that needs insurance companies to deal with psychological health and substance use conditions as they would any other medical condition. Although therapy can be expensive, this mental health parity act assists guarantee that all people have equivalent pass and protection under their insurance coverage prepares when it comes to seeking help with their psychological health needs.

Mental health crisis
A psychological health crisis is a situation in which there is a substantial opportunity that a person may harm themselves or others and can not securely take care of themselves.

According to Mind, a psychological health company based in the UK, an individual may experience a crisis due to:

addiction or substance abuse
school or work stress
relationship stress
financial or real estate problems
struggles with a psychological health diagnosis
trauma
abuse
the loss of an enjoyed one
NAMI reports that signs of a mental health crisis might include:

difficulty ending up tasks such as bathing, rising, and changing clothes
increased agitation
verbal risks
residential or commercial property damage
rapid mood modifications
self-harm
psychosis and losing touch with reality
failure to recognize family and friends
increased substance use
withdrawal from enjoyed ones and activities
obstacles managing stress
If they think that they are experiencing a mental health crisis however are not in instant danger, NAMI suggests that a person call their therapist or psychiatrist. The mental health specialist can evaluate the scenario and identify the very best course of action.

Anybody in a possibly life threatening circumstance must call 911 or their regional emergency situation number, or go to the nearby emergency situation room. The personnel will link the individual with a mental health expert who can require and evaluate the threat for assistance.

How do deductibles work and just how much do I need to pay of pocket?
When you pick a medical insurance plan, it’s important to look at your overall health care expenses. This implies that you will require to think about how much you spend for your health insurance monthly along with your deductible, copayments, and out-of-pocket expenses.

A deductible is just how much you have to invest for health services that are covered by your insurance before your insurance company pays for anything.

In some kinds of strategies, you might have a low monthly medical insurance cost or premium every month, however a high deductible. This suggests you should invest more on health care that receives insurance payments prior to being covered by your plan.

In other cases, your monthly insurance coverage premium may be higher but your deductible is lower. This means you have to invest less on healthcare each year before your insurance protection starts.

How much you have to pay out of pocket depends upon your plan. Talk with your employer or insurance coverage supplier to discover the right health insurance for you.

What is covered by HSAs and fsas?
Both a health care flexible costs account (FSA) and a health savings account (HSA) can help you conserve cash on health costs, including some online therapy services.

An FSA is a savings account developed by your company with a part of your month-to-month pay. It permits you to conserve cash by not paying earnings taxes on the part in your FSA. You can use this account to spend for out-of-pocket healthcare expenditures, such as online therapy.

You can typically contribute up to only a certain amount to your FSA. Depending upon your company, you may have access to the funds immediately when you register or after you have contributed a substantial quantity.

An HSA works similarly to an FSA. To contribute to an HSA, you should certify and meet specific requirements, such as:

You are not enrolled in Medicare.
You are not declared as a depending on your partner’s or anyone else’s income tax return.
You have a high deductible health insurance (HDHP), implying you pay more for health costs covered by insurance.
An essential distinction between an FSA and an HSA is that an FSA stays with an employer, and you might lose access if you alter work.

On the other hand, an HSA is portable. You can take it with you from company to employer.

Ask your employer whether they use an FSA or HSA. Not all companies use these tax-saving tools for health expenditures.

Here are some key points to think about relating to insurance coverage and treatment:

In-Network vs. Out-of-Network Providers: Medical insurance plans usually have a network of preferred service providers. In-network companies have a contracted agreement with the insurance company and deal services at a lower expense to insured people. Out-of-network service providers might likewise be covered, but the protection might be limited, and you may have to pay a greater portion of the expense.
Copayments, Deductibles, and Coinsurance: Depending upon your strategy, you may be responsible for copayments (a fixed fee per session), deductibles (the quantity you require to pay out-of-pocket prior to insurance coverage begins), or coinsurance (a percentage of the cost you are accountable for after fulfilling the deductible). It is necessary to understand how these elements apply to therapy services.
Preauthorization and Referrals: Some insurance strategies might need preauthorization or referrals from a primary care physician or psychological health expert prior to you can get protection for therapy. This is done to guarantee that the treatment is clinically essential.
Protection for Different Types of Therapy: Insurance coverage for therapy normally consists of different kinds of treatment, such as specific therapy, group treatment, household therapy, and couples treatment. The specifics may vary, so it’s crucial to check your strategy’s coverage details.
Protection Limits: Insurance coverage strategies typically have limitations on the variety of treatment sessions covered within a particular time period. They may cover a certain number of sessions per year or have restrictions on the period of treatment. Understanding these limits is essential to planning your therapy.

Protection for Different Mental Health Issues: Insurance strategies normally cover treatment for a wide range of mental health conditions, consisting of depression, anxiety conditions, drug abuse, and more. Protection might differ based on the seriousness and type of condition, so it’s suggested to review the specifics of your plan.

Health insurance in America plays a crucial function in helping families and individuals access essential healthcare while handling healthcare costs. Here are some key aspects of health insurance in the United States:

Kinds Of Medical Insurance: There are several types of medical insurance in the U.S. The most typical types consist of employer-sponsored insurance (supplied by employers to their staff members), government-sponsored programs like Medicare (for people aged 65 and older) and Medicaid (for low-income people and households), and specific strategies acquired straight from insurance provider or through the Medical Insurance Marketplace.

Protection Options: Health insurance coverage varies depending on the plan. It typically includes a range of services such as hospital stays, doctor check outs, preventive care, prescription drugs, and sometimes psychological health services. The specific coverage information, deductibles, copayments, and coinsurance quantities vary by strategy and can affect the out-of-pocket expenses for policyholders.
Cost-Sharing: In the majority of medical insurance plans, individuals share the expenses of their health care through deductibles, copayments, and coinsurance. Deductibles are the amount people must pay out-of-pocket prior to insurance coverage starts. Copayments are fixed charges spent for particular services, while coinsurance is a percentage of the overall expense of care that individuals are responsible for.
Network Providers: Medical insurance strategies typically have a network of preferred providers, consisting of hospitals, experts, drug stores, and physicians. They typically get higher levels of coverage when people get care from in-network suppliers. Out-of-network suppliers might still be covered, however at a higher cost to the insured individual.

Open Registration Period: The Medical Insurance Marketplace, developed under the Affordable Care Act (ACA), offers people and families the chance to enroll in health insurance plans throughout the yearly open registration duration. Particular life events, such as task loss or marriage, might qualify individuals for a special enrollment period outside of the basic open enrollment period.
Preexisting Conditions: Under the ACA, health insurance business can not deny coverage or charge higher premiums based upon pre-existing conditions. This arrangement makes sure that individuals with preexisting health conditions have access to inexpensive medical insurance coverage.
Aids and Financial Support: The Medical insurance Market offers financial assistance in the form of exceptional tax credits and cost-sharing decreases for qualified individuals and households with low to moderate incomes. These aids help reduce the expense of medical insurance premiums and out-of-pocket costs.

Medicaid and Medicare: Medicaid provides health insurance protection to low-income people and families, while Medicare is a federal program that mostly serves people aged 65 and older. Both programs play essential roles in ensuring access to health care for susceptible populations.

Medical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A): HIPAA safeguards individuals’ health details by establishing privacy and security rules for health insurance strategies, service providers, and other health care entities.
